Уважаемые пользователи!
C 7 ноября 2020 года phpBB Group прекратила выпуск обновлений и завершила дальнейшее развитие phpBB версии 3.2.
С 1 августа 2024 года phpBB Group прекращает поддержку phpBB 3.2 на официальном сайте.
Сайт официальной русской поддержки phpBB Guru продолжит поддержку phpBB 3.2 до 31 декабря 2024 года.
С учетом этого, настоятельно рекомендуется обновить конференции до версии 3.3.

Мод Global Announcement - Глобальное объявление

Ответы на вопросы, связанные с модами для phpBB 2.0.x, кроме относящихся к форуму Для авторов (phpBB 2.0.x).
Аватара пользователя
MuzDmitry
phpBB 1.2.1
Сообщения: 26
Стаж: 17 лет 3 месяца
Откуда: г. Королёв Московской области
Контактная информация:

Сообщение MuzDmitry »

Палыч писал(а):Unknown column 'a.auth_globalannounce'
Это я понимаю кое-как и без Translate.ru .

Но как это поправить?
Аватара пользователя
Палыч
Former team member
Сообщения: 9683
Стаж: 17 лет 10 месяцев
Откуда: Питер
Благодарил (а): 3 раза
Поблагодарили: 454 раза
Контактная информация:

Сообщение Палыч »

MuzDmitry писал(а):Но как это поправить?
Ручками, выполнить SQL запрос через phpmyadmin, например

Добавлено спустя 8 минут 29 секунд:

Код: Выделить всё

ALTER phpbb_1_auth_access ADD auth_globalannounce TINYINT (1) not null AFTER auth_announce;
Не все то WINDOWS, что висит... phpBB только учусь.
ICQ, email, ЛС - только для личных сообщений. Вопросы по phpbb только на форумах. По найму не работаю.
Аватара пользователя
MuzDmitry
phpBB 1.2.1
Сообщения: 26
Стаж: 17 лет 3 месяца
Откуда: г. Королёв Московской области
Контактная информация:

Сообщение MuzDmitry »

Ответ MySQL:

#1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'phpbb_1_auth_access ADD auth_globalannounce TINYINT (1) not nul
Добавлено спустя 3 минуты 31 секунду:

На http://restorany-koroleva.ru пока сделал откат.

Для выяснения осталась ошибка на http://maestro-prazdnik.ru/forum
Аватара пользователя
Палыч
Former team member
Сообщения: 9683
Стаж: 17 лет 10 месяцев
Откуда: Питер
Благодарил (а): 3 раза
Поблагодарили: 454 раза
Контактная информация:

Сообщение Палыч »

MuzDmitry
сорри, table забыл, могли бы и сами догадаться 8)

Код: Выделить всё

ALTER table phpbb_1_auth_access ADD auth_globalannounce TINYINT (1) not null AFTER auth_announce;
Не все то WINDOWS, что висит... phpBB только учусь.
ICQ, email, ЛС - только для личных сообщений. Вопросы по phpbb только на форумах. По найму не работаю.
Аватара пользователя
MuzDmitry
phpBB 1.2.1
Сообщения: 26
Стаж: 17 лет 3 месяца
Откуда: г. Королёв Московской области
Контактная информация:

Сообщение MuzDmitry »

Спасибо огромное! Получилось!

Только не могу понять: я этот запрос выполнял раза три до того - почему не было результата? Ведь это точная строка из руководства по установке мода?

И еще вопрос: там есть еще строка
ALTER TABLE phpbb_forums ADD auth_globalannounce TINYINT (2) DEFAULT "3" NOT NULL AFTER auth_announce;
Ее нужно выполнить?

И еще раз спасибо!

Добавлено спустя 40 минут 33 секунды:

А есть возможность в этом моде игнорировать некоторые темы?
Аватара пользователя
Поручик
Former team member
Сообщения: 3942
Стаж: 18 лет 10 месяцев
Откуда: Оренбург (Южный Урал)
Благодарил (а): 24 раза
Поблагодарили: 54 раза
Контактная информация:

Сообщение Поручик »

Нет, ее выполнять не надо. Это автор мода просто от нечего делать ее написал.
Профессионал - тот же дилетант, только знающий, где ошибётся.
Генератор db_update.php для phpBB2 с некоторыми удобствами. Многие моды я беру или ищу здесь, здесь, тут
Все консультации только на форуме, приваты и стук в аську по таким вопросам игнорируются!
FAQ-phpBB3 | Ошибки новичков, или как не поссориться с модератором | Правила конференции

наш форум http://forum.aeroion.ru/cat1.html
Аватара пользователя
MuzDmitry
phpBB 1.2.1
Сообщения: 26
Стаж: 17 лет 3 месяца
Откуда: г. Королёв Московской области
Контактная информация:

Сообщение MuzDmitry »

Ну вот, пришел Поручик... :D
Аватара пользователя
RedNaxi
Former team member
Сообщения: 933
Стаж: 17 лет 1 месяц
Откуда: BeBoss.ru
Благодарил (а): 2 раза
Поблагодарили: 14 раз

Сообщение RedNaxi »

http://phpbbmodders.net/viewtopic.php?t=853
Скачал с этой ссылки последнюю версию мода 1.5.0
Установил на форум phpBB2.0.22
Еще установлены моды text buttons,Birthday(не помню чей), photo album smartora, last topic on index page. quick reply, attachment mod, мод, отображающий подпись в профиле, еще не помню как называется, позволяющая первый пост показывать на всех страницах темы. Вроде всё.
После установки мода в точности по инструкции ничего не изменилось. Как было невозможно сделать тему важным объявлением так и осталось невозможно. просто нет такого пункта при созданиитемы.
С чем это может быть связано?


Перепроверил все файлы, все изменения произведены так же как описано в моде.

Добавлено спустя 18 минут 52 секунды:

обнаружена еще одна странность - добавил в одном форуме тему, во всех остальных появилась тема-фантом: без автора,без заголовка, на главной она не подсчитывается как тема(на количество тем не влияет) , создана 1 января 1970 года, при попытке открыть последнее сообщение говорит что тема не существует. Что за странность? как установить мод?
Iftin
phpBB 2.0.7
Сообщения: 573
Стаж: 18 лет 10 месяцев
Откуда: Moscow
Контактная информация:

Сообщение Iftin »

угу страности с 1970 точно, у меня например в моде репутация http://www.phpbbguru.net/community/file ... 09_933.jpg =)
что-то популярная ошибка...
почитай эту тему может тебе поможет , мне нет http://www.phpbbguru.net/community/view ... light=1970
Hall9000
phpBB 1.0.0
Сообщения: 2
Стаж: 16 лет 11 месяцев

Сообщение Hall9000 »

YarNET писал(а):
мод Global announcement
В нем есть иконки, которые после установки мода не отображаются почему-то. Вместо них просто появляются иконки стандартных объявлений... Как исправить?

Добавлено спустя 3 часа 9 минут 50 секунд:

Проблема была решена, после того как более внимательно был изучен название_шкуры.cfg
Оказалось, что вся проблема была в моде Simply Merge Threads

А точнее в этом фрагменте кода

Код: Выделить всё

//-- mod : merge -----------------------------------------------------------------------------------
//-- add
$images['topic_mod_merge'] = "$current_template_images/topic_merge.gif";
//-- fin mod : merge -------------------------------------------------------------------------------
//-- mod : topics list -----------------------------------------------------------------------------
//-- add
$images['folder_global_announce']		= "$current_template_images/folder_announce.gif";
$images['folder_global_announce_new']		= "$current_template_images/folder_announce_new.gif";
$images['folder_global_announce_own']		= "$current_template_images/folder_announce_own.gif";
$images['folder_global_announce_new_own']	= "$current_template_images/folder_announce_new_own.gif";
$images['folder_own']				= "$current_template_images/folder_own.gif";
$images['folder_new_own']			= "$current_template_images/folder_new_own.gif";
$images['folder_hot_own']			= "$current_template_images/folder_hot_own.gif";
$images['folder_hot_new_own']			= "$current_template_images/folder_new_hot_own.gif";
$images['folder_locked_own']			= "$current_template_images/folder_lock_own.gif";
$images['folder_locked_new_own']		= "$current_template_images/folder_lock_new_own.gif";
$images['folder_sticky_own']			= "$current_template_images/folder_sticky_own.gif";
$images['folder_sticky_new_own']		= "$current_template_images/folder_sticky_new_own.gif";
$images['folder_announce_own']			= "$current_template_images/folder_announce_own.gif";
$images['folder_announce_new_own']		= "$current_template_images/folder_announce_new_own.gif";
//-- fin mod : topics list -------------------------------------------------------------------------
Мод Simply Merge Threads и мод Global announcement используют одинаковое описание

Код: Выделить всё

$images['folder_global_announce']

Код: Выделить всё

$images['folder_global_announce_new']
Именно из-за этого не отображались "родные" иконки из Global announcement

Поменяв соответствующим образом код проблема была решена:

измененный код

Код: Выделить всё

//-- mod : merge -----------------------------------------------------------------------------------
//-- add
$images['topic_mod_merge'] = "$current_template_images/topic_merge.gif";
//-- fin mod : merge -------------------------------------------------------------------------------
//-- mod : topics list -----------------------------------------------------------------------------
//-- add
$images['folder_global_announce'] = "$current_template_images/folder_global_announce.gif";
$images['folder_global_announce_new'] = "$current_template_images/folder_global_announce_new.gif";
$images['folder_global_announce_own'] = "$current_template_images/folder_global_announce.gif";
$images['folder_global_announce_new_own'] = "$current_template_images/folder_global_announce_new.gif";
$images['folder_own'] = "$current_template_images/folder_own.gif";
$images['folder_new_own'] = "$current_template_images/folder_new_own.gif";
$images['folder_hot_own'] = "$current_template_images/folder_hot_own.gif";
$images['folder_hot_new_own'] = "$current_template_images/folder_new_hot_own.gif";
$images['folder_locked_own']	 = "$current_template_images/folder_lock_own.gif";
$images['folder_locked_new_own'] = "$current_template_images/folder_lock_new_own.gif";
$images['folder_sticky_own'] = "$current_template_images/folder_sticky_own.gif";
$images['folder_sticky_new_own'] = "$current_template_images/folder_sticky_new_own.gif";
$images['folder_announce_own'] = "$current_template_images/folder_announce_own.gif";
$images['folder_announce_new_own'] = "$current_template_images/folder_announce_new_own.gif";
//-- fin mod : topics list -------------------------------------------------------------------------
Изменяли это:
$images['folder_global_announce'] = "$current_template_images/folder_global_announce.gif";
$images['folder_global_announce_new'] = "$current_template_images/folder_global_announce_new.gif";
$images['folder_global_announce_own'] = "$current_template_images/folder_global_announce.gif";
$images['folder_global_announce_new_own'] = "$current_template_images/folder_global_announce_new.gif";
Скажите, что это дает?
К примеру у меня вот что вышло:
Users:
daiver 42
187-М 40
Шкипер 29
Brut Kirby 54
ElxKepka 4

...

и т.д.
Parshuto

Сообщение Parshuto »

Ребята,

а как этот мод к ресурсам относится?
У меня стоял версии 1.2.8 - пришлось снести, так как нагружал сервер конкретно :(
Что с версией 1.5.0?
Аватара пользователя
PAN1N
phpBB 1.0.0
Сообщения: 6
Стаж: 16 лет 11 месяцев
Откуда: Ставрополь
Контактная информация:

Сообщение PAN1N »

Поставил версию из раздела "Моды", столкнулся с распространенной проблемой - тема видна только при модерации.

Почитал, понял что проблема в строке
$topic_type = ( in_array($topic_type, array(POST_NORMAL, POST_STICKY, POST_ANNOUNCE)) ) ? $topic_type : POST_NORMAL;

Но в модуле posting.php её не нашел! Меня глючит?
Чтобы понять рекурсию, надо понять рекурсию
Аватара пользователя
Поручик
Former team member
Сообщения: 3942
Стаж: 18 лет 10 месяцев
Откуда: Оренбург (Южный Урал)
Благодарил (а): 24 раза
Поблагодарили: 54 раза
Контактная информация:

Сообщение Поручик »

Глючит. Поиск по неполному совпадению может дать счастье.

Код: Выделить всё

#------ [ FIND ] -------------
$topic_type = ( in_array($topic_type, array(POST_NORMAL, POST_STICKY,
Добавлено спустя 2 минуты 43 секунды:

А, блин! PAN1N, какая у вас версия двига? Эта строка появилась в 2.0.17
Профессионал - тот же дилетант, только знающий, где ошибётся.
Генератор db_update.php для phpBB2 с некоторыми удобствами. Многие моды я беру или ищу здесь, здесь, тут
Все консультации только на форуме, приваты и стук в аську по таким вопросам игнорируются!
FAQ-phpBB3 | Ошибки новичков, или как не поссориться с модератором | Правила конференции

наш форум http://forum.aeroion.ru/cat1.html
Аватара пользователя
PAN1N
phpBB 1.0.0
Сообщения: 6
Стаж: 16 лет 11 месяцев
Откуда: Ставрополь
Контактная информация:

Сообщение PAN1N »

Поручик писал(а):А, блин! PAN1N, какая у вас версия двига? Эта строка появилась в 2.0.17
2.0.11. Можно как-нибудь вдохнуть жизнь? Или бум всех делать модераторами? =)))
Чтобы понять рекурсию, надо понять рекурсию
Аватара пользователя
Палыч
Former team member
Сообщения: 9683
Стаж: 17 лет 10 месяцев
Откуда: Питер
Благодарил (а): 3 раза
Поблагодарили: 454 раза
Контактная информация:

Сообщение Палыч »

PAN1N писал(а):2.0.11. Можно как-нибудь вдохнуть жизнь?
Легко - обновить до 2.0.22
Не все то WINDOWS, что висит... phpBB только учусь.
ICQ, email, ЛС - только для личных сообщений. Вопросы по phpbb только на форумах. По найму не работаю.
Закрыто

Вернуться в «Поддержка модов для phpBB 2.0.x»